The density of air is 1.2 kg/m3. It can be expressed in g/cm3 by:

Correct answer: D. 1.2 x 10^-3

  • A. 1.2 x 10^6
  • B. 1.2 x 10^3
  • C. 1.2 x 10^-6
  • D. 1.2 x 10^-3

Explanation

To convert kg to g we will multiply by 1000. To convert cm to m we divide by 100 so, to convert cm3 to m3 we will divide by 1003 = 1000000.1.2 x 1000 = 12001200 / 1000000 = 0.0012 0.0012 = 1.2 x 10-3

About Measurements

Physical quantities are expressed with SI base and derived units, while measurement limits are described through accuracy, precision, absolute and percentage error, and significant figures. Dimensional analysis checks equations, derives relationships and detects inconsistent units, but it cannot determine numerical constants or distinguish quantities with identical dimensions.
